Queen Letizia has resumed her institutional agenda with a day of audiences at the Zarzuela Palace, where she received representatives from various organizations.
Among them were members of the Proyecto Hombre Association, young Colombians and Peruvians receiving scholarships from the BBVA Microfinance Foundation, and staff from the Spanish Society of Pulmonology and Thoracic Surgery.
For these engagements, she opted for a look she had worn in the past, this time with a stylistic twist that made all the difference.
Queen Letizia in a gray dress by Adolfo Domínguez
The Queen chose a pearl gray cotton dress by Adolfo Domínguez.
This design, with a boat neckline, long sleeves with shirt cuffs, and an asymmetrical midi skirt, stands out for its gathered waist, which enhances the silhouette without the need for eye-catching accessories.
Letizia wore it for the first time in 2023 during a Netflix and FAD Juventud event, although at that time she paired it with flat sandals due to a foot injury.
Today, the outfit took on a new lease of life thanks to a pair of nude slingbacks by Magrit. The slight heel of the shoes, more flattering in proportion to the length of the dress, brought greater harmony to the ensemble.
As her only visible accessories, she wore mixed-design hoop earrings and her usual Coreterno ring, a piece that has become emblematic of her personal style.
